Saddam's Capture, Top Priority:bremer
Edited on Sat Nov-01-03 11:06 AM by leftchick
http://story.news.yahoo.com/news?tmpl=story&u=/afp/20031101/wl_mideast_afp/iraq_us_saddam&cid=1514&ncid=1480

<snip>BAGHDAD (AFP) - Saddam Hussein (news - web sites) is alive in Iraq (news - web sites), and "his capture or his killing is our top priority," US civil administrator Paul Bremer said.


"We believe that Saddam is alive, is in Iraq, and his capture or his killing is our top priority," Bremer told a news conference here.


"We stil have no clear indication if Saddam himself is behind these attacks," Bremer said in a reference to the upsurge of bombings and killings.
